There was a problem hiding this comment.
Avoid sourcing a mutable remote shell script in a credentialed job.
This step executes shell fetched from another repo’s branch head at runtime while the GitHub app keys are mounted. Any change in that external branch can silently change this job’s behavior or read the mounted credentials without a corresponding review here. Please keep the env values in this config (or another reviewed file in this repo), or at least fetch a pinned immutable revision instead of refs/heads/oadp-dev.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Fail fast if release discovery returns no tag.
If the GitHub API call is rate-limited or its output stops matching this pipeline, UPSTREAM_VERSION becomes empty and the job still calls rebasebot with an invalid source ref. Add set -euo pipefail, curl --fail, and an explicit non-empty check before invoking rebasebot.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Filter out peeled annotated tags before picking the latest release.
git ls-remote --tags returns both refs/tags/<tag> and refs/tags/<tag>^{} for annotated tags. With the current head -n 1, MOST_RECENT_UPSTREAM_RELEASE can end up as vX.Y.Z^{}, which makes the --source ref invalid and breaks the job.
